Two suggestions for improvement:
First : consider using state
to store the values of the name and message inputs.
Second : extract the fetch
functionality into its own function to improve code organisation and maintain single responsibility.

Well, we can create a single reusable fetch
function to handle the fetching logic, like:
function fetchMessages(url, options) {
return fetch(url, options)
.then((response) => response.json())
.then((data) => data.slice().reverse());
}
then you can use it for both getMessages
and setMessages
:
function getMessages() {
fetchMessages("https://module-servers.onrender.com/messages")
.then((data) => setMessages(data));
}
//...
const requestOptions = {
method: "POST",
headers: {
"Content-Type": "application/json",
},
body: JSON.stringify(newMessage),
};
fetchMessages("https://module-servers.onrender.com/messages", requestOptions)
.then((data) => setMessages(data));
There are different ways to do that, you can update it according to your taste ;)
